## Thumbnail queue (Snapcrumb)

The thumbnailer pulls jobs off the Snapcrumb queue and writes results to the warm cache. If the queue backs up, it's almost always the GIF resizer choking on huge uploads — just requeue those with the oversize flag. Don't bump worker counts without checking memory first. The current queue settings the workers boot with are these:

deployment values, taweg-bajop:
[fenvan]
port = 5672
team = holmir
host = fenvan.orvexio.example
region = lower-1
access_code = ac_b98bc6
timeout_ms = 1500

**Handover — Marit to Doran, Tollbridge billing worker**

Support team: the blue-green deploy for the Tollbridge billing worker is mid-flight. Blue is serving live traffic; green has the new proration logic and passes smoke tests. Do not flip the router until the reconciliation job finishes at 02:00. If green's vault seals itself during the switch (it has twice), unseal it with the recovery passphrase that follows.

unlock words, yawig-kagef: gordor-holvan-ulaael-pramir-ulaiel-tamdor

### Authentication

The GridSmith crossword generator exposes its puzzle-compilation endpoint only on the internal mesh. Every request must carry a bearer credential issued by the Wardkey service; scopes are limited to `grid:compile` and `grid:validate`, and all calls are logged immutably for audit. For reviewer verification of the logging path, use the internal key provided below.

app token of tagef-tafog = qvz3-7n0

Ticket: Memgauge profiler agents failing to connect since last night's deploy. Affects all Vexhart Labs GPU clusters running agent v4.2. Symptoms: handshake timeout after 30s, then retry loop. Restarting the collector does not help. Suspect the profiling results database moved during the infra shuffle and agents still cache the old endpoint. Support: have affected users clear the agent cache and reconnect using the connection string below.

primary connection of tawif-yajeg = postgresql://rusiel_svc:G879q9cx6GsSvj@db-dd9f.norvagrid.internal:5432/casath